Form 41 Schedule T-100(f) provides flight stage data covering both passenger/cargo and all cargo operations in scheduled and nonscheduled services. The schedule is used to report all flights which serve points in the United States or its territories as defined in this part.
Form 41 Financial Schedule consists of financial information on large U.S. certified air carriers--includes balance sheet, cash flow, employment, income statement, fuel cost and consumption, aircraft operating expenses, and operating expenses.

The Report of Financial and Operating Statistics for Large Certificated Air Carriers is a document that provides detailed financial and operational performance data for major airlines. This report includes statistics on revenues, expenses, passenger numbers, cargo traffic, and other key metrics.
Large certificated air carriers, which are airlines that hold a certificate issued by the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) and operate scheduled air services, are required to file this report.
To fill out the report, airlines must gather relevant financial data and operational statistics from their financial systems. They must then accurately input this information into the standardized reporting format provided by the regulatory authority, ensuring compliance with all specified guidelines.
The purpose of the report is to provide regulatory authorities, industry stakeholders, and the public with transparent and comprehensive data regarding the financial and operational health of large airlines, allowing for informed decision-making and policy development.
The report must include information such as total operating revenue, total operating expenses, passenger enplanements, available seat miles (ASM), revenue passenger miles (RPM), cargo traffic statistics, and other relevant operational metrics.
